"Absolutely the worst"
Pros: None to speak of
Cons: Bad billing, bad reception, bad calls
Summary: I have had four phone carriers. While Verizon is not the absolute worst, it is the second worst in my opinion. First, let's talk call quality. I had three cell phones with Verizon over a two year period. It should not matter what phone a customer has, the call quality should still meet some standard. I went from a cheap, freebie phone to a very expensive phone and still had tinny, hollow-sounding calls. Second, billing was awful. When I started with Verizon, I could either mail my bill or drive all the way across town to pay it in person. Since I only had a credit card at the time and no checking account, that was an annoyance. It WAS the age before the really customer-oriented websites, but still... Also, I never had the same bill twice. I stayed within my minutes almost every time, overages maybe two months out of my two year contract. And yet, my bill was never a standard price. They were always jacking me around for one thing or another, even though I didn't sign up for extra services. Lastly, calls would drop for no reason. I would stand still in a spot where I had four or more bars and the call would still drop for no reason. I will never go with Verizon again.
